Wall of Silence

T431819135
After the death of her father by a mindless gang, Natalie struggles to make ends meet as a law student. As she does her best to look after her younger brother Craig, she turns to stripping to put food on her table. With her mother in a psychiatric ward, Natalie knows she cannot live like this any longer. What does it take for a young female university student to want to take someone's life. How would you feel if your father was brutally murdered and nobody wanted to help? How can she break the Wall of Silence.
